SMBC Aviation Capital Joins Acquisition of Air Lease Corporation, Strengthening Affiliate's Position in Aircraft Leasing Industry

SMBC Aviation Capital, an affiliate of Sumitomo Mitsui Financial Group Inc., announced its participation in the acquisition of the U.S.-based Air Lease Corporation. The acquisition will be executed through a newly formed entity, Sumisho Air Lease Corporation, which will be jointly owned by SMBC Aviation Capital, Sumitomo Corporation, Apollo managed funds, and Brookfield. SMBC Aviation Capital will hold a 4.99% voting-rights stake and a 24.99% economic-interest stake in the new entity. As part of the acquisition, SMBC Aviation Capital will acquire Air Lease Corporation's aircraft on order and will serve as the asset servicer for most of Sumisho Air Lease's fleet, solidifying its standing in the aircraft leasing sector.
